Output 591d5c24bf590e8626f2996518a371632379e9153198a2bcb1f6d751054c20a4:20

value
521348490857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2fd71bb72b446c9d8aa2f938ef84c80e7c8db8 OP_EQUAL
address
2N8m6AtsTBi3DyLRDtfx6Fht5ookwb1JtHu
transaction
591d5c24bf590e8626f2996518a371632379e9153198a2bcb1f6d751054c20a4